The fight against crime and smuggling in Iraq
Law enforcement authorities in Iraq report today, July 2, 2026, on intensified operations on two main fronts: the war on drugs and attempts to stop capital smuggling from the country.
According to reports by واحد العراق and وكالة الأنباء العراقية (واع), the Counter-Terrorism Service carried out arrest operations of two drug traffickers, alongside conducting extensive sweeping operations in various areas. The news was also confirmed by وكالة بغداد اليوم الاخبارية, which noted that this is a continuous effort by security forces in this field.
At the same time, وكالة بغداد اليوم الاخبارية reports that the Integrity Commission (the commission for combating corruption) has reached agreements with the Central Bank of Iraq. The parties agreed to take steps to "dry up money smuggling routes", a move intended to tighten financial supervision in the country.
